Writes `.meta.json` with `gateway: "fal-proxy"`, model id, `model_family`, request, and cost. ## Output - `` — PNG (≥ 1 KB). - `.meta.json` — request + result metadata + cost, including `model_family` (`gpt-image-1` or `gpt-image-2`). ## Quality Checks - Output file exists and is > 1 KB. - For character anchors: visually inspect against the descriptor block (hair, shirt color, age). - `meta.json` includes `gateway: "fal-proxy"`, the resolved `model` id, `model_family`, `image_size`, and `quality`. - For gpt-image-2 custom sizes: confirm the output dimensions match the requested `WIDTHxHEIGHT`. - **No readable text in the prompt that should appear in the image.** AI image models mangle short brand text, URLs, code tokens, captions, and wordmarks even with explicit prompting. Examples observed: `"ffmpeg"` → `"ffmmg"`; `"klarify"` → `"clarify"`; `"therapists"` → `"therapits"`. Use PIL or `ffmpeg drawtext` for any overlay containing readable text. Reserve image gen for purely visual content (characters, scenes, backgrounds).
